Boynton

Proper noun

Meaning

(countable) A habitational surname from Old English.

(uncountable) A placename:
A village and civil parish in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England (OS grid ref TA136682).

A town in Muskogee County, Oklahoma, United States.

An unincorporated community in Catoosa County, Georgia, United States.

An unincorporated community in Sullivan County, Missouri, United States.
